Transaction 68addc66ae37ec99cb49219929378e96b9efeb845d4958a8ebb6f760dbcd2a48
2 Input
2 Outputs
- 68addc66ae37ec99cb49219929378e96b9efeb845d4958a8ebb6f760dbcd2a48:0
- 68addc66ae37ec99cb49219929378e96b9efeb845d4958a8ebb6f760dbcd2a48:1
value 1014755
address 1DicvWMZL9MMXSApaL4Kz5Zp6wrrwJKRtE
value 21259459
address 37aFvvGVoZY7k6ePdLeVRv6DUxzJbve5y6